<h1>Barkskin</h1>
<ul>
<li><strong>Level</strong>: 2</li>
<li><strong>Classes</strong>: Cleric, Druid, Ranger</li>
<li><strong>Casting Time</strong>: 1 action</li>
<li><strong>Range</strong>: Touch</li>
<li><strong>Components</strong>: V, S, M (A handful of oak bark.)</li>
<li><strong>Duration</strong>: Up to 1 hour</li>
<li><strong>Source</strong>: <a href="http://dnd.wizards.com/articles/features/systems-reference-document-srd">5e Core Rules</a></li>
</ul>
<p>You touch a willing creature. Until the spell ends, the target's skin has a rough, bark-like appearance, and the target's AC can't be less than 16, regardless of what kind of armor it is wearing.</p>
